"Hate" I believe is one of those words, ("bully" and "racist" are two others that come immediately to mind) where it seems to have become fashionable in some quarters to apply the word to all sorts of situations where a reasonable understanding of the term would indicate it wouldn't apply.
I think it's unfortunate when this happens, because words like these, when properly applied describe real and serious problems, and so when they are thrown around indiscriminately and applied inappropriately the result is a trivializing of the serious aspect, and a cheapening the value and meaning of the terms.
